The Vital Function of the Outboard Bearing Carrier
The outboard bearing carrier is a critical part of your boat's propulsion system. It houses and supports the bearings that allow the propeller shaft to rotate smoothly, ensuring optimal performance of the outboard engine.
- Bearing Support: The outboard bearing carrieris designed to hold the propeller shaft bearings in place, providing the necessary support for the shaft to rotate without excessive friction or wobbling. This support is vital for the propeller's efficiency, allowing the boat to move smoothly through the water.
- Seal Protection: This component also plays a crucial role in protecting the bearings from water and debris, which can lead to corrosion and wear. The outboard bearing carrieris typically equipped with seals that prevent water intrusion, ensuring the longevity of the bearings.
- Easy Maintenance: Regular inspection and maintenance of the outboard bearing carrierare essential. Checking for wear and tear, replacing seals, and ensuring the bearings are well-lubricated can prevent unexpected failures and keep your outboard engine running efficiently.
Marine Wheel Bearings: Ensuring Smooth Sailing
Marine wheel bearings are essential for the smooth operation of boat trailers, ensuring that your vessel can be transported safely to and from the water. These bearings are specifically designed to withstand the harsh conditions of marine environments.
- Corrosion Resistance: Marine wheel bearingsare typically made from corrosion-resistant materials, such as stainless steel or coated metals. This resistance is crucial as the bearings are frequently exposed to water, salt, and other corrosive elements that can cause standard bearings to fail prematurely.
- Load Management: These bearings bear the load of the boat and trailer, allowing the wheels to spin freely and reducing friction. Properly functioning marine wheel bearingsensure that the trailer remains stable and the wheels turn smoothly, reducing the risk of accidents during transportation.
- Regular Greasing: To maintain the performance of your marine wheel bearings, it’s important to keep them well-greased with marine-grade lubricant. This helps to prevent rust and corrosion, ensuring the bearings remain in good condition for longer.
The Role of Ship Shaft Bearings in Maritime Operations
Ship shaft bearings are vital components in larger vessels, supporting the ship’s propeller shaft and ensuring the efficient transfer of power from the engine to the propeller. These bearings are designed to handle the heavy loads and harsh conditions found in marine environments.
- Durability and Strength: Ship shaft bearingsare typically made from high-strength materials capable of withstanding the enormous forces generated by the ship's engine and propeller. They are designed to endure the constant stress and pressure that comes with maritime operations.
- Vibration Reduction: These bearings help reduce vibrations and noise, ensuring a smoother and quieter operation of the ship. This is particularly important for maintaining the structural integrity of the vessel and ensuring the comfort of those on board.
- Water and Lubrication Management: Effective sealing systems are essential for ship shaft bearingsto prevent water ingress and maintain proper lubrication. Regular inspection and maintenance are crucial for preventing bearing failure and ensuring the long-term reliability of the ship’s propulsion system.

Preventing Bearing Breakdowns: Maintenance Tips
Preventing bearing breakdowns in marine applications requires regular maintenance and attention to detail. Here are some tips to keep your bearings in top condition:
- Regular Inspections: Frequently inspect all bearings, including the outboard bearing carrier, marine wheel bearing, ship shaft bearings, and venture trailer wheel bearings. Look for signs of wear, corrosion, or damage, and address any issues immediately.
- Proper Lubrication: Use the appropriate marine-grade lubricants to ensure your bearings remain well-lubricated. This prevents rust and reduces friction, prolonging the life of the bearings.
- Seal Maintenance: Check the seals regularly and replace them if they show signs of wear or damage. Effective seals are essential for keeping water and contaminants out of the bearing assembly.
- Load Management: Ensure that your trailer and vessel are not overloaded. Excess weight can put additional stress on the bearings, leading to premature failure.
